BUTTERWORTH - Four youths were hauled to court today to face multiple charges of robbing, raping and molesting a female Chinese national and gang robbing her partner earlier this month.
Wan Noorsaipul Abdullah, Muhammad Fuzairi Azmi, both 23, Mohamad Kamal Masiran, 25, and Mohamad Azrul Azlan Mohamad, 19, were jointly charged at a Sessions Court here with robbing the 21-year old Chinese national of her Gucci handbag, CK watch, RM1,000 and USD1,000, a gold chain, a gold bracelet, an iPhone 5 and a camera at the Penang Bridge rest stop about 3.30am on August 3.
Azrul Azlan and Fuzairi also faced another charge of raping the woman ‎in Sungai Lokan, between 3.30am and 7.07am on the same day.
The four were also jointly accused of gang robbing ‎one Tan Chin Meng, 46, of RM1,000, his smartphone and several automated teller machine (ATM) cards and hurting him in the process, at the Penang Bridge rest stop about 3.30am on the same day.
Meanwhile, in a magistrate's court, Wan Noorsaipul was charged with using criminal force with intent to outrage the modesty of the 21-year-old at the Sungai Lokan industrial area, between 3.30am and 7.07am, on the same day.
All four claimed trial to their respective charges before Sessions Court judges Julie Lack Abdullah and Roslan Hamid‎, as well as magistrate Muhammad Firdaus Abdul Wahab.
All cases will be re-mentioned on Sept 23. The four have been granted a total bail amount of RM95,000.
Fuzairi was represented by V. Guha, while the other three accused were unrepresented.
Deputy Public Prosecutors Lim Cheah Yit, Fauziah Daud and ‎Khairul Fairuz Rahman prosecuted in the respective courts. -NST
